Alonaki/Ammoudia

44

This small pebble beach lies near the juncture of the Acheron River and the sea. Parking is available as well as a snack bar and showers.

Parga

The picturesque seaside village of Parga is a short 15-minute drive from the Acheron River and is surrounded by the 3 sandy beaches of Lichnos, Krioneri and Valtos. Each are located minutes from one another and all offer clean water plus a variety of cafes, tavernas and shops mere footsteps away.

Ai Yiannaki

If you prefer peace and quiet, the beach of Ai Yiannaki is a great option. Just outside the village of Parga, this pebble beach is perfect for relaxing under the sun.

Bay of Kerentza

This sheltered bay offers protection on windy days and the fact that it’s only accessible by foot means that it’s never too crowded. Surrounded by greenery and featuring shallow water, it’s popular with families who don’t mind the short walk to get here.

Loutsa

One of the larger beaches in the area, this sandy beach is a popular destination for families and is famed for its excellent tavernas which serve up some of the best seafood in the area.
